Hello MCDawn Community,
I'm going to be taking down the Official MCDawn Minecraft Classic server soon, however other servers and MCDawn website etc will still stay up.
If anyone has any objections or questions etc, post a reply below.
UPDATE: I've taken the server down, and as promised, here is the archive of all the levels: omslevels.zip (161.3 MB)
To view the levels, download MCDawn server, start it once (to let the folders/files generate), shut down server, put the contents of the downloaded archive in the "levels" folder,and then restart server, and then you are free to do /g <worldname>.

Hello MCDawn Community,
MCDawn v1.0.2.1 has been released.
PushBall game has been completed (which is basically Minecraft soccer), so check that out.
The rest of the changes are generally just bug fixes and smaller newer features.
